One Love Animal Rescue looking for new home, donations for stray dog

One Love Animal Rescue announced today they have taken in an abused and abandoned dog from Southern New Jersey. The shelter intake photographs showed a mostly hairless young lab mix with red, raw, and scabbed skin. “Buckley” was a stray brought to the shelter by Animal Control.

After Buckley’s seven-day stray hold was over, One Love brought him into their rescue and immediately took him to the veterinarian. His medical evaluation revealed that he is approximately 10 to 12 months old, underweight, and positive for heartworm disease, Lyme disease, and Demodectic Mange. Buckley’s recovery will take months, but One Love is prepared to give him all the care he needs. His personality is sweet and gentle despite the neglect he endured.

“Buckley survived brutal neglect and cruelty,” said Sherri Smith, the rescue’s chairwoman. “When we saw his picture and story, we quickly made room for him in our rescue. We will spare no expense of time or money to help him put this nightmare behind him. After all he’s been through; he deserves to start new life as a healthy and cherished family pet.”

With the help of social media and a couple of news organizations, One Love has already raised about $1500 for Buckley’s care. Rescues cannot take in seriously ill animals without this kind of support.

“It makes us really proud and thankful that we are able to help Buckley,”said Stephanie Hawkins, co-founder of One Love. “Our rescue has a lot of experience with caring for very sick dogs, so we are prepared to give sweet Buckley anything he needs to recover both physically and emotionally.”
